I've been searching all over, and perhaps my search-fu is lacking, but I can't seem how to enable mods for Civ VI on Mac with Steam. Is this possible? Have I bought the wrong version? A solution would be the best Christmas present ever.

Thanks,
chris
 
As far as I know they are enabled. You just have to put the extracted mod folder into the correct location on your hard drive. If I recall correctly, that's the following folder:

~/Library/Application Support/Sid Meier Civilization VI/Mods/

You can access the hidden ~/Library/ folder in the Finder by holding down the Alt key while selecting the Go menu, then selecting Library.

Dredging up an old thread rather than start a new one... found this folder (again) but I'm also in need of where the stuff is stored for mods subscribed to off the steam workshop. I need to comment out a line or two of a mod (author told me which lines for what I want) but I can't find the file. The spolight search did not work.
 
Steam Workshop mods should end up in the same folder as listed above in my previous post
 
Nope, not there. The only files there are the ones I added. And all four do show up in the right spot in the game, but all the steam ones (also in the game) are not in that location.

I did find a ...application support->steam->steamapps->workshop but couldn't find anything in there that I could identify as mod files.
 
Can't speak to Mac file structure, but in Windows that steamapps/workshop folder contains a "content" folder that contains one or more numbered folders, each corresponding to a game for which you downloaded mods and containing more numbered folders, each containing a single zip file. If you open those zip files, there are the mod files.
